Can we avoid relegation for the 4th season on the trot this is the worst situation in those 4 years that we've been in with 9 games to go.

Previously with 9 games to go we were:

  • 2004/5 16th with 44 points - 3 points off relegation with a game in hand
  • 2005/6 18th with 40 points - 8 points off relegation
  • 2006/7 16th with 46 points - 9 points off relegation
  • 2007/8 21st with 41 points - 2 points off relegation having played 2 games more than the 22nd placed team

Even last season having not won for 10 games and with 3 games to go we were better placed being 5 points away from relegation prior to two successive away wins and we were shitting ourselves then!

Are we going to lose our exclusive position in the group of 9 teams never to have played below Division 2?

Will we no longer be able to proudly proclaim:

And then there were NINE - Man United, Chelsea, Arsenal, Liverpool, Everton, West Ham, Tottenham, Newcastle and LEICESTER

Will I be watching Division 3 football for the first time in 45 years of supporting Leciester City Football Club.
